Understanding Highland Park Whisky

Highland Park whisky originates from Scotland’s Orkney Islands, where traditional methods and natural ingredients play a crucial role in its production. The brand is especially famous for its use of heather peat, which gives its whisky a distinctive, lightly smoky character.

Among its range, the most popular expression in the U.S. market is the Highland Park 12 Year Old. However, the brand also offers older and more premium bottles, which significantly affect the overall pricing spectrum.


Average Price of Highland Park Whisky in the USA

The price of Highland Park whisky in the United States depends largely on the age statement and rarity of the bottle. Below is a general breakdown of what you can expect:

Highland Park 12 Year Old

  • Average price: $50 – $70 (750ml)
  • This is the most widely available and best-selling option. It offers excellent value for money and is often considered a benchmark for entry-level single malts.

Highland Park 15 Year Old

  • Average price: $80 – $110
  • Slightly more refined, with deeper oak and spice notes. Less common than the 12-year but still accessible.

Highland Park 18 Year Old

  • Average price: $150 – $200
  • A premium expression known for its complexity and smoothness. Frequently rated among the best Scotch whiskies in its category.

Highland Park 21 Year Old and Older

  • Price range: $250 – $500+

Why Prices Vary Across the United States

If you’ve searched for Highland Park whisky prices, you may have noticed differences depending on where you shop. Several factors contribute to this variation:

1. State Taxes and Regulations

Alcohol pricing in the U.S. is heavily influenced by state laws. Some states impose higher taxes, which can increase the retail price significantly.

2. Retailer Differences

Prices can vary between:

  • Local liquor stores
  • Large retail chains
  • Online alcohol marketplaces

Online retailers sometimes offer better deals, but shipping costs and legal restrictions may apply.

3. Availability and Demand

In areas where Scotch whisky is in high demand, prices may be slightly higher. Limited stock or supply chain issues can also drive prices up.

4. Bottle Size and Packaging

While most prices are based on a standard 750ml bottle, larger or gift-pack editions can cost more.
